Why Your Nissan Tire Pressure Light Illuminates

The low tire pressure light on your Nissan dashboard is a critical warning signal, indicating that one or more tires are significantly underinflated. This situation demands immediate attention as driving on underinflated tires can lead to uneven wear, poor handling, increased fuel consumption, and a heightened risk of tire failure or accidents. Understanding why this light appears is the first step toward resolving it and restoring proper tire monitoring.

Several factors can trigger the Nissan tire pressure sensor reset warning. The most common culprit is, predictably, actual low tire pressure. This can occur due to slow leaks, punctures, temperature fluctuations (as colder air decreases pressure), or simply losing air over time. Another frequent cause is incorrect tire inflation after a tire rotation or replacement. If the new tires aren't inflated to the manufacturer's specifications, or if the system isn't properly recalibrated after the service, the light may falsely illuminate.

Common Causes of False Alarms

Sometimes, the light might appear without an obvious deflation issue. This can happen if the tire pressure monitoring system (TPMS) sensors themselves are experiencing a malfunction, low battery, or are out of sync with the vehicle's receiver. Extreme temperature shifts can also cause temporary discrepancies that the system flags. For models like the Nissan Sentra, ensuring the correct tire pressure for that specific vehicle is paramount, as over or underinflation can confuse the sensors.

The simplest resolution often involves addressing the underlying tire pressure issue directly. This means checking each tire's inflation level against the recommended PSI found on the driver's side doorjamb sticker, not the maximum pressure listed on the tire sidewall. This specific figure is crucial for your vehicle's performance and the accuracy of its monitoring system.

How to Perform a Nissan Tire Pressure Sensor Reset

When the low tire pressure light appears, and you've confirmed all tires are inflated to the correct pressure (e.g., the recommended tire pressure for a Nissan Sentra), the next step is to reset the system. This process tells the car's computer that the current tire pressures are the baseline. For most modern Nissan vehicles, this reset is often automatic after driving a short distance at normal speeds (typically 15-20 miles per hour) once the correct pressure is established.

However, some Nissan models, particularly older ones or those with specific TPMS configurations, may require a manual reset procedure. This often involves using buttons on the steering wheel or dashboard. For instance, you might need to navigate through the vehicle's information display menu to find the 'TPMS' or 'Tire Pressure' setting and select 'Reset' or 'Initialize'. The exact steps can vary, making it crucial to consult your vehicle's owner's manual for model-specific instructions. Manual Reset Steps for Many Nissan Models

For many Nissan models that don't reset automatically, the process typically involves the following:

  1. Ensure all tires are inflated to the correct PSI as specified on the driver's side doorjamb sticker.
  2. Turn the ignition key to the 'ON' position (without starting the engine).
  3. Locate the TPMS reset button. This is often found under the dashboard, near the steering column, or integrated into the instrument cluster.
  4. Press and hold the TPMS reset button until the tire pressure warning light blinks several times or turns off.
  5. Turn the ignition off, then back on.
  6. Drive the vehicle for at least 10 minutes at a speed of 20 mph or higher to allow the sensors to communicate and recalibrate.

If the light persists after these steps, it might indicate a more complex issue. This could involve a faulty TPMS sensor, a problem with the TPMS control unit, or a leak that is too slow to be immediately obvious. In such cases, a professional diagnostic scan is recommended.

Preventing Future Tire Pressure Issues

Preventing the low tire pressure light from constantly reappearing involves consistent maintenance and awareness of your tires' condition. The most effective strategy is regular manual tire pressure checks, ideally once a month and before long trips. Use a reliable tire pressure gauge – a Haltec dual foot tire pressure gauge, for example, offers precision. This proactive approach allows you to catch minor pressure drops before they trigger the warning light and become a significant issue.

Temperature fluctuations are a major factor affecting tire pressure. For every 10°F (5.6°C) change in ambient temperature, tire pressure can change by about 1 PSI. This means that a vehicle properly inflated on a warm day might show a low-pressure warning on a cold morning. Being aware of seasonal changes and adjusting pressure accordingly is crucial. Regular Checks and Tire Care

Beyond simple inflation, regular tire inspections for wear and tear are vital. Look for uneven wear patterns, cuts, bulges, or embedded objects. These can indicate underlying problems that might lead to leaks or blowouts. If you've recently had tires rotated, balanced, or replaced, always confirm the correct pressure has been set, and if necessary, perform the Nissan tire pressure sensor reset procedure as outlined in the previous section.
